Discover the Iconic Barre Opera House
Located in the heart of central Vermont, the Barre Opera House is a historic treasure that has served as a cultural and artistic epicenter for over a century. First opening its doors in 1899, the Opera House has withstood time, fire, renovation, and reinvention to become one of New England’s most cherished performing arts venues.
Initially built to showcase plays, lectures, and musical performances for a booming granite town, the venue quickly gained a reputation for hosting renowned artists, regional productions, and civic events. After a devastating fire in 1914, the Opera House was rebuilt and eventually restored in the late 20th century to preserve its Victorian charm while adding modern comforts. Today, the venue features a diverse lineup of entertainment, including national touring acts, classical music, theater, dance, community performances, and children’s programming.
With its stunning proscenium arch, acoustically rich setting, and ornate yet cozy atmosphere, Barre Opera House offers guests an intimate, unforgettable experience steeped in historic elegance.

Seating Recommendations and Charts
The Barre Opera House accommodates approximately 650 guests, making it an intimate and acoustically vibrant venue where every seat feels close to the stage.
Seating is typically divided into:
- Orchestra/Main Floor – The most popular section with direct access and excellent sightlines. Ideal for guests seeking to be up close and immersed in the performance.
- Balcony – Elevated view offering a broad perspective of the stage. These seats are especially coveted for classical music and dance performances where acoustics and full-view choreography matter.
- Box Seats – Limited and elegant, offering a unique vantage point and a sense of historic prestige.

Location and Transportation
Venue Address
Barre Opera House
6 N Main Street
Barre, VT 05641
- Parking: Street parking is available throughout downtown Barre, with public lots within walking distance of the venue. Metered and free spaces are available depending on time of day.
- Public Transit: The Green Mountain Transit (GMT) bus service offers several routes connecting Barre to Montpelier and other nearby communities.
- Rideshare & Drop-Off: Uber, Lyft, and local cab services operate in the area. A convenient drop-off point is located directly in front of the main entrance on North Main Street.

Other Things to Do in Barre
Make the most of your visit by exploring this charming New England city:
- Rock of Ages Granite Quarry – A massive, active quarry with guided tours and scenic views.
- Vermont Granite Museum – Discover Barre’s unique stoneworking history through interactive exhibits.
- Studio Place Arts – A lively arts center offering galleries, workshops, and classes.
- Hope Cemetery – A remarkable outdoor museum of granite craftsmanship and sculpture.
